When you have finished using the SCB-8, power off any external signals connected to the SCB-8 before you power off your computer.
Mounting Holes You can mount the SCB-8, either vertically or horizontally, on a DIN rail in an industrial environment. You can purchase a compatible DIN rail kit from NI using the part number 781740-01.
